A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.Trader consensus prices KT Wiz at even money for this KBO matchup at Changwon NC Park, capturing the competitive balance between early-season leaders KT (7-3, .301 batting average, 6-0 away) and host NC Dinos (6-4, 3.13 ERA). KT's offensive firepower and March sweep of NC (8-2, 6-2) fuel their edge, but NC's stingy rotation and home-field advantage counterbalance, especially amid KT's recent loss and NC's three-game skid. Lingering injuries—NC ace Riley Thompson (oblique) out since preseason, KT reliever Won Sang-hyun (elbow surgery)—strain bullpens, while unannounced probable starters and final lineup reports could tip probabilities either way in this evenly poised contest.
